How Solar Trackers Maximize Efficiency

Solar tracking systems aren’t new—they’ve been used in utility-scale projects for decades. But recent price drops (a 62% cost reduction since 2010) make them viable for homes and businesses. Here’s the kicker: single-axis trackers boost output by 25-35%, while dual-axis models can hit 45% in regions with variable sunlight angles.

Tracking Mechanics Made Simple

Think of trackers as AI-powered gardeners for your panels. Using light sensors and algorithms, they tilt panels toward the sun’s position. Some advanced models even predict cloud movements using weather APIs. Cool, right? But wait, there’s a catch

The Game-Changing UPS Mode

Here’s where inverter UPS mode steals the show. Traditional inverters shut down during grid failures to protect utility workers—a safety feature called “anti-islanding.” UPS-enabled inverters? They create a microgrid using stored battery power, keeping your fridge running and Wi-Fi alive. It’s like having a silent generator that never needs gasoline.
